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 DEF
The recycling of the solvent perchlorethylene used in dry cleaning. 1, record 1, English, - dry%20greening
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 CONT
The cleaning solvent perchlorethylene (commonly known as "perc") is used in dry cleaning, although it is a suspected carcinogen that contaminates groundwater and landfill sites when dumped. Technology is available that allows dry cleaning to reclaim most of the fluid for reuse. 2, record 1, English, - dry%20greening
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 OBS
The formation of the neologism dry greening appears to be a play on words in the form of a rhyme. This is a form of class-maintaining derivation as the new lexeme replaces "clean" in "dry cleaning" with "green" based on the new concept of a green transition characteristic of the late 1980s. 1, record 1, English, - dry%20greening
